DE LA ROSA-PEREZ, David A.; TEUTLI-LEON, Ma. Maura Margarita  e  RAMIREZ-ISLAS, Marta E.. Polluted soils electroremediation, a technical review for field application. Rev. Int. Contam. Ambient [online]. 2007, vol.23, n.3, pp.129-138. ISSN 0188-4999.

During the last two decad the interest for developing remediation technologies for polluted soils treatment has been increasing. Several techniques have been oriented to get in situ remediation, in this context electroremediation is an attractive technique due to their potential for removing both organic and inorganic pollutants. The present work is a technical review about polluted soil remediation by electroremediation, this work covers the following aspects: electrokinetics fundamentals, pollutant removal mechanisms, and an analysis of the main variables as well as their influence over the process, and improvements for increase the efficiency; also it is included a foresight of field applications.

Palavras-chave : polluted soil; remediation; electroremediation; heavy metals; organic pollutants.
